#c7924e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c7924e is composed of 78% red, 57.3%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.6% magenta, 60.8%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 33.7 degrees, a saturation of 51.9% and a lightness of 54.3%. #c7924e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9c with #8f2500.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#c7924e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#fbf7f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c7924e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#918b84 is the less saturated color, while #fd9918 is the most saturated one.
